这里是文章模块栏目内容页
redis客户端py(redis客户端连接主机的命令)

导读:

Redis是一个高性能的NoSQL数据库,它提供了多种数据结构和灵活的操作方式。Python是一种流行的编程语言,有很多优秀的Redis客户端库可以使用。本文将介绍如何使用Python编写基于redis-py库的Redis客户端程序。

总结:

本文通过对redis-py库的介绍和实例演示,详细讲解了如何使用Python编写Redis客户端程序。通过这篇文章的学习,读者可以了解到Redis客户端的基本操作和常用命令,以及如何使用Python编写Redis客户端程序。同时,读者也可以深入了解redis-py库的使用方法和原理,为后续的开发工作打下良好的基础。

1. 安装redis-py库

在Python中使用redis-py库需要先安装该库,可以使用pip命令进行安装。安装完成后,在Python代码中引入redis模块即可。

2. 连接Redis服务器

使用redis-py库连接Redis服务器非常简单,只需要指定Redis服务器的IP地址和端口号即可。连接成功后,就可以执行各种Redis命令了。

3. Redis数据类型

Redis支持多种数据类型,包括字符串、哈希表、列表、集合和有序集合等。每种数据类型都有对应的Redis命令可以进行操作。

4. Redis命令

Redis命令是操作Redis数据的关键,redis-py库提供了丰富的Redis命令接口。常用的Redis命令包括set、get、hset、hget、lpush、lrange、sadd、smembers、zadd和zrange等。

5. Redis事务

Redis支持事务操作,即一次性执行多个Redis命令,这些命令要么全部执行成功,要么全部执行失败。使用redis-py库可以轻松实现Redis事务。

6. Redis管道

Redis管道是一种批量执行Redis命令的方式,可以大幅度提高Redis的性能。使用redis-py库可以方便地使用Redis管道。

7. Redis发布订阅

Redis支持发布订阅模式,即客户端可以订阅某个频道并接收该频道上的消息。使用redis-py库可以轻松实现Redis发布订阅功能。

8. Redis分布式锁

Redis分布式锁是一种基于Redis实现的分布式锁机制,可以保证在分布式环境下的数据一致性。使用redis-py库可以方便地实现Redis分布式锁。

最多5个TAGS:Python、Redis、redis-py、NoSQL、数据库